NAME

glab-config-set - Updates configuration with the value of a given key.

SYNOPSIS

glab config set [flags]

DESCRIPTION

Use glab config set --global to write to the global configuration. Specifying the --host flag also saves to the global configuration file.

OPTIONS

-g, --global[=false] Write to global '~/.config/glab-cli/config.yml' file rather than the repository's '.git/glab-cli/config.yml' file.

--host="" Set per-host setting.

OPTIONS INHERITED FROM PARENT COMMANDS

-h, --help[=false] Show help for this command.

EXAMPLE

glab config set editor vim
glab config set token xxxxx --host gitlab.com
glab config set check_update false --global
